    Superb Transitional Louis XV- Louis XVI period caned chair bearing the label of the carpenter Sébastien Carpentier. Original painted walnut. Sebastien Carpentier received his master's degree in 1770 in Lyon, a pupil of Pierre Nogaret. Its original label is glued to the inside of the back rail: "Le sieur Carpantier, Maître menuisier, demeurant dans la rue de l'Arbre-sec, au premier étage, à Lyon, fait et vend toutes sortes de Meubles en Fauteuils, Chaises, Canapés, Ottomanes, Duchesses, & autres, tant en cannes, que prêts à être garnis ; toutes sortes de Lits avec leurs Impériales, & généralement tout ce qu'il faut pour meubler les Appartements dans le dernier goût. Those who wish some of his articles, may come and see models, & he will accommodate them at very good prices." Stable and in good condition (minor damage to cane). 18th century Lyonnais work.
